Barre, VT & N. Woodstock, NH – Thunder Road Speedbowl and White Mountain Motorsports Park officials jointly announced today a landmark partnership with Barre, Vermont’s Absolute Spill Response. The local specialists in environmental and industrial clean up have partnered to support the Safety Team of the two sister tracks in providing new and improved waste oil containment systems and speedi-dry solutions to keep both the Thursday and Saturday night programs running smoothly after any on-track calamity!

GM Poised to Sign New Supercars Deal
General Motors is set to sign a new agreement with Supercars, ensuring the Chevrolet Camaro races on in the championship in 2025 and beyond.
Supercars struck a deal with GM in 2020 for the development of a Gen3 Camaro race car, the IP of which is owned by the championship.
It was a critical move for the category following the demise of GM’s Australian brand Holden, keeping the long running racetrack rivalry with Ford alive. (more…)
INDYCAR And FOX Sports Announce Historic Media Rights Deal
INDYCAR and FOX Sports today announce the new exclusive home of the NTT INDYCAR SERIES and the iconic Indianapolis 500 presented by Gainbridge beginning in 2025. The new media rights deal provides a massive and unprecedented increase in exposure for North America’s premier open-wheel racing series, with every 2025 race airing on FOX and available on the FOX Sports app. FOX Deportes will carry exclusive Spanish-language television coverage with a schedule to be announced at a later date.
Josh Bilicki Joins Joe Gibbs Racing In The No. 19 Toyota GR Supra In Multi-Race Deal
HUNTERSVILLE, N.C. (May 21st, 2024) – Joe Gibbs Racing (JGR) announced today that Josh Bilicki will pilot the No. 19 Toyota GR Supra for multiple races throughout the remainder of the 2024 NASCAR Xfinity Series (NXS) season.

Central Asphalt Pens Three-Year Deal as White Mountain Tiger Triple Crown Sponsor
N. Woodstock, NH — A longtime New Hampshire supporter of short track stock car racing has returned to the White Mountain Motorsports Park family of sponsors. Officials take great pride in announcing that Jefferson, New Hampshire’s Central Asphalt Paving is now the presenting sponsor for the Flying Tiger Triple Crown Series at White Mountain over the next three seasons.
